Job Description:
As an Administrative Coordinator for CPA Canada’s Standards group, you will effectively project manage activities undertaken by the Standards group’s marketing communications team and provide administrative support to the Standards group’s oversight councils and their related committees. You will also manage and ensure your department’s flawless functioning, oversee the budget process, and support corporate KPI measurement activities.
Job Responsibilities:
- Author or lead responses to public consultations and ad-hoc requests on behalf of CPA Canada to regulatory and government bodies (e.g.,
- Canadian Securities Administrators, Finance Canada, IAASB)
- Research and develop non-authoritative guidance and thought leadership (market-driven and forward-looking publications, webinars, blogs, presentations, podcasts) by building on own subject matter expertise and working collaboratively with key internal and external stakeholders
- Under the direction of the VP Regulatory Affairs, oversee creation and distribution of resources on Anti-Money Laundering and prepare feedback on FINTRAC interpretation bulletins
- Oversee and manage specific projects within the area of responsibility. This project oversight will include creating and managing the project budget, directing authors/consultants, translation, design, web content, contracts, expense reports and relevant marketing and communication efforts. Also, proactively identify, address and resolve issues in each of these areas
- Manage authors, consultants, volunteers and related contracts for project completion
- Conduct background and supportive research on topics
- Oversee development of leading-edge guidance materials for boards and audit committees of not-for-profit and public organizations and their senior management
- Manage volunteer committees, working groups and task forces, including facilitating/presenting at meetings
- Design and propose thought-leading projects to the COG Board
- Manage communications of Board decisions and activities
- Promote and positively profile CPA Canada as a credible source of resources
- Support CPA Canada’s Foresight program by initiating or managing projects in the data governance or value creation priorities
